Step into Egypt’s history with a guided tour that blends the ancient world with Cairo’s vibrant heritage. From the legendary Pyramids of Giza to the fascinating Museum of Egyptian Civilization, the grand Salah El Din Citadel, the sacred lanes of Old Cairo, and the colorful Khan el-Khalili Bazaar, this flexible experience lets you design the day to fit your interests. Stand before the Great Pyramids of Giza, one of the Seven Wonders of the Ancient World. Explore the Great Pyramid of Khufu, marvel at the Pyramids of Khafre and Menkaure, and hear stories of their construction and mysteries. End your visit with the Great Sphinx, the lion-bodied guardian whose gaze has watched Giza for millennia. At the National Museum of Egyptian Civilization, trace Egypt’s story from prehistory to modern times. The highlight is the Royal Mummies Hall, where ancient kings and queens are remarkably preserved. Galleries connect Egypt’s past with its present. The Salah El Din Citadel, towering over Cairo, offers sweeping views and the Mosque of Muhammad Ali, an Ottoman masterpiece. The fortress tells stories of battles and rulers. In Old Cairo, wander through narrow alleys alive with centuries of tradition. Visit the Hanging Church and Ben Ezra Synagogue, landmarks of faith and culture. Then explore Khan el-Khalili Bazaar, where spices, silver, textiles, and crafts fill the lively market.
